Kinda long but bear with me, and if you want i should have a twitch vod of a full run.

I am a one trick pony of wilbur/cornelius/nezgleckt/heiner from back to front. Wilbur is the battery of the group giving energy to the carry, and then eventually the entire team. Nezgleckt is the support spamming skills and giving card draw to the carry, and then eventually everyone. Heiner is the tank to give fortify to cornelius while giving block to everyone. And cornelius burns the entire universe on fire! I don’t use self burn cornelius. I also get Wilbur an upgraded shock nova at act 1 so i can get speed control, even with a slow team. I even take electrocute act 4 to have speed control vs twins hanshek and archon. Nezgleck gets the +3 sight perk because otherwise his healing isnt enough for shorter fights and the damage piles up. Two important items for me are dryad crown for +2 fast for wilbur and lost mail for wilbur, they are both in act 1 so you can go wherever you want after. I don’t even go red portal because ignidoh is very hard with only corn dps but i never needed to.

My favorite cornelius startegy by far rgiht now in madness 16 is to play it with heiner with fortify, reginald with bless and nezgleckt with card draw. Up until act 4, cornelius can clear everything with aoe, one problem is that you cant go to red zone, but the rewards there arent that important anyway, as everything up to act 4 is incredibly easy imo. At act 4, I’ve started to adjust my deck so that i remove aoe’s because of the many thorns and enchantments act 4 has. Getting phoenix with a repeat card (especially recurring nightmare) does the trick most of the time.

If you don’t want to accept an argument where the whole team buffs cornelius, he can still solo carry up to act 4 with less help because of his aoe’s until act 4. My first win with cornelius was like that, as it carried a reginald carry up to act 4, where reginald started doing most of the work.

Sure, first of all good luck to your future healing adventures.
I'm using 1h nature simply because its my favorite weapon out of all the healing options, and right now its also the best in the nature tree. The basic idea is to make sure everybody has q stacks when you are using your e, since the 1h nature e heals based on how many stacks each person has.
I'm using protection of nature as a w, simply because it gives a lot survivability for 1 person every 15 seconds.
I'm using eye of secrets as an off-hand for energy regenaration, which, combined with lymhurst cape, is enoguh to last almost indefinitely even in a long fight.
A cleric robe is a very good defensive for any healer, and in some cases I'm able cast my e more safely, as cleric robe bubble makes casts uninterruptable.
Graveguard helmet is usually neccessary for nature healers in small numbers, because nature doesn't have fast healing like holy, so in case of an emergency it is needed.
Cleric sandals is a good way to dodge some abilites, mainly mace stuns and other crowd control abilites.
The food I'm eating is an avalonian pork omelette, because of the defensives it gives alongside with cooldown reduction.
And the potions are always resistance potions. It can save you from a lot of bad situations.

Honestly i dig heiner that goes tank and starts going ham dps when he’s lvl3 and 4, if you guys are doing the red portal boss and they let you take the volcanic axe, you can put it on heiner and use bluffs, cheap attacks and shield charges to do good damage to bosses. Make sure you still have some block cards to at least keep up the fortify on your friends. There is also a perk that lets you stakc fortify to 50 which also increases your damage, and a perk (ottis takes this one) that gives block per fortify charge. Bluffs and shield charges start doing massive damage. I won madness 16 with this. On ottis sanctify is actually a pretty decent answer if your friends are going to enemy thorns, just have more sanctify at them then thorns and youre good to go. I’d say try only one of these first, then see if you can do them both. Keep in mind if you go sanctify stuff on ottis heiner will have to hit from time to time to get healed.
